Regulatory Changes and Responsible Gaming
As gaming technology advances, so too will regulations. In 2026, expect stricter guidelines aimed at promoting responsible gaming. Casinos will need to implement measures that protect players, such as spending limits and self-exclusion programs. These changes will foster a safer environment, allowing players to enjoy their favorite games while minimizing risks.
